For the last fifteen years the Swedish International Development Cooperation Agency provided financial support to environment and development initiatives in the Baltic Sea region. One of these initiatives, the "Agriculture and Environment in Leningrad Oblast" program, was pointed out as successful in establishing a multi-stakeholder pilot activity in North West Russia. This book is taking the reader on a research enquiry through the second phase of the AELO program, named "Agriculture, Environment and Ecosystem Health in North West Russia", exploring the interactions between multi-stakeholder processes with communication and coordination, based on the concept of "Multi-stakeholder platform" as a "space for change". For this, Soft System Methodology methods and techniques are used to appraise the second phase program's communication and coordination imprints and its Multi-stakeholder platform.
